Mercersburg Shooting Today: Police Respond to Reported Gunfire in Franklin County as Investigation Continues

Police responded to a reported shooting in Mercersburg, Pennsylvania on Friday morning along Montgomery Church Road. Authorities secured the area as the investigation remains ongoing.

Mercersburg, Pennsylvania — Law enforcement officials responded Friday morning to reports of a shooting incident in the Mercersburg area of Franklin County, prompting a large emergency response and ongoing investigation.

Police Respond to Early Morning Incident

According to initial reports, Pennsylvania State Police were dispatched to the 600 block of Montgomery Church Road following emergency calls reporting possible gunfire in the area.

Emergency responders arrived at the scene and secured the area while beginning an investigation into what occurred.

Area Secured as Investigation Begins

Authorities established a perimeter and restricted access to the roadway as officers worked to gather evidence and speak with potential witnesses.

At this time, officials have not confirmed details about any victims, suspects, or injuries connected to the incident.
